WebMar 29, 1999 · Alternating Current Motor. An alternating current motor is similar to the direct current motor except for a few characteristics. Instead of the rotor field reversing every half turn, the stator field reverses every half turn. There are several different types of alternating current motors. WebAug 29, 2024 · The universal motor is a type of electric motor that can work on direct current (DC) and single-phase on AC supply. For this reason, they are called universal. However, it is more common to use them in alternating current mainly because it is the current form that reaches homes. WebFeb 14, 2015 · The problem is that even at low speed (low frequency), the square-wave’s amplitude is always at 650 Vdc bus voltage for 480-V motors.
